How Music Boosts Advertising Success
The use of music in ads is a key factor in grabbing attention, evoking feelings, and increasing memorability. Picking suitable music can change a basic advertisement into a powerful brand message that resonates deeply with audiences.
Why Music Matters in Ads
In effective advertising, soundtracks play a significant role that can evoke feelings, set the tone, and guides audience perception. The right advertising music complements the visual message and can convey meaning beyond text.
Building Emotional Bonds with Music
Data proves that soundtracks and jingles build stronger bonds with a product or service. A distinctive melody can stay in the listener’s mind, increasing brand recognition and increasing customer interest.
Selecting the Right Music for Your Ad
Picking tunes for commercials needs insight into your customers, brand identity, and the campaign’s message. The music should:
- Suit the atmosphere – energetic, mellow, serious, or light-hearted, depending on the ad’s style.
- Align with brand personality – traditional, modern, innovative, or trustworthy.
- Suit the cultural context – fitting the preferences of your viewers.
- Support the narrative – not distracting from the visuals.
Original vs Licensed Music
You can opt for custom music or pre-existing music for product advertising songs. Original music provides a unique sound, but can be costlier and slower to produce. Licensed music provides instant recognition but requires licensing rights.

Music Types That Work Well
Music styles shape perception. Commonly used genres include:
- Mainstream tunes – energetic and accessible.
- Classical – timeless and refined.
- Blues – smooth and cool.
- Synth-based – modern and energetic.
- Folk – warm and authentic.

Where to Get Music for Commercials
There are several ways to obtain music for advertising:
- Online music marketplaces – websites offering pre-made tracks.
- Original soundtrack production – working with music agencies for tailored pieces.
- Working with local talent – adding authenticity.
Legal Considerations When Using Music in Ads
Securing the correct music licences is essential to avoid legal problems. This includes synchronisation rights, public performance rights, and mechanical rights, depending on where and how the ad is shown.
